Question 1: What is the turns ratio of a single-phase transformer with a 480V primary winding and a 120V secondary winding?
- 2:1
- 4:1 (Correct answer)
- 8:1
- 16:1
Correct answer: 4:1
Turns ratio equals primary voltage divided by secondary voltage: 480V รท 120V = 4:1.
Question 2: A 25 kVA, single-phase, 480V/240V transformer is operating at full load. What is the approximate rated secondary current?
- 52A
- 104A (Correct answer)
- 156A
- 208A
Correct answer: 104A
Secondary current = kVA ร 1,000 รท secondary voltage = 25,000 รท 240 โ 104A.
Question 3: Which three-phase transformer connection provides a neutral conductor on the secondary side?
- Delta-Delta
- Delta-Wye (Correct answer)
- Wye-Delta
- Open Delta
Correct answer: Delta-Wye
A Delta-Wye transformer provides a neutral from the center point of the wye-connected secondary windings.
Question 4: According to NEC 450.3(B), a 480V transformer with a rated primary current of 9A requires primary overcurrent protection not exceeding what value?
- 9A
- 11.25A
- 15A (Correct answer)
- 25A
Correct answer: 15A
NEC allows 125% of 9A = 11.25A; since no standard device matches that value, the next standard size of 15A is permitted.
Question 5: What is the primary purpose of a K-rated transformer?
- To provide voltage regulation above 10%
- To handle harmonic currents from non-linear loads (Correct answer)
- To improve the system power factor
- To reduce audible transformer noise
Correct answer: To handle harmonic currents from non-linear loads
K-rated transformers are built to withstand the additional heat generated by harmonic currents produced by non-linear loads such as computers and variable frequency drives.
Question 6: A 75 kVA, three-phase, 480V/208Y/120V transformer is operating at full load. What is the approximate full-load secondary line current?
- 104A
- 156A
- 208A (Correct answer)
- 360A
Correct answer: 208A
Full-load secondary current = kVA ร 1,000 รท (secondary line voltage ร โ3) = 75,000 รท (208 ร 1.732) โ 208A.
Question 7: What type of transformer is designed to make small voltage adjustments, typically within ยฑ5โ20% of the supply voltage?
- Autotransformer
- Isolation transformer
- Buck-boost transformer (Correct answer)
- Potential transformer
Correct answer: Buck-boost transformer
Buck-boost transformers are designed to raise (boost) or lower (buck) supply voltages by a small percentage to compensate for voltage variations.
